Deep lakes are stratified during the summer and winter. In summer, the lake will have three different temperature zones. The epilimnion is the surface layer that is warmed by the sun. The thermocline is the middle layer that decreases 1oC per meter of depth. The lowest layer is the hypolimnion and is cold water. The warmer, less dense water floats on top of the colder, more dense water.
